This month Jill Kovacevich and Aleks Woodroffe, your CO-Hosts, tackle a wide range of myths circulating in scent detection sports ("Nosework"? "Scent Work"? we dive into that too!). Drawing from their experience as trainers, judges, officals and competitors, they systematically dismantle misconceptions that might be limiting your dog's potential OR your perception of your dog's limitations!


The conversation dives into three critical areas: myths about dogs, handlers, and the environment. Ever heard that panting dogs can't detect odor? Or that small dogs are at a disadvantage? Perhaps you've been told fast-working dogs are inherently better performers? These are just a few of the beliefs the hosts analyze and refute with compelling examples from their experiences.

Whether you're new to scent sports or a seasoned competitor, this episode offers fresh perspectives that will transform how you approach training and trials. Listen now, and stay tuned for the second installment where they'll tackle HANDLER myths that might be sabotaging your search success!
